A German-based company called Feelbelt wants to take that immersion even deeper with a wearable haptic belt capable of transmitting the entire frequency spectrum from 1 to 20,000 Hz in the form of haptic feedback. You control feelbelt through the Feelbelt app available on iOS and Android. Image Credit: Feelbelt.

Could this wearable device solve the headache that is typing in VR? Currently, entering your password and username or typing out a message in VR means awkwardly selecting keys using your motion controllers. You can also summon arrow keys with your left pinky finger for cursor control. You can do some pretty amazing things in VR.

Although Samsung has confirmed that Project Moohan will have its own controllers, I didn’t get to see or try them yet. I was told they haven’t decided if the controllers will ship with the headset by default or be sold separately. So it was all hand-tracking and eye-tracking input in my time with the headset.
